Using Simulation to Predict Cavitating Flow

Oct. 6, 2022
Learn how to conduct accurate, full-scale simulation of propellers.

This paper examines the challenges of simulating cavitating flows, especially flows around propellers. First the sources of various errors are highlighted: the accuracy of geometry, grid quality and fineness, turbulence modeling and cavitation modeling. The interaction between errors from different sources is also discussed.
